Output dd1cd515a280deebc3f50ba828e4e5413e2e4e08ff0d18672779f1978cc512d7:4

value
95950785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f4c6b2098c7918977a1d27a9946ff85c7a6064 OP_EQUAL
address
3QfEm3BtiQTpmZdBezHBHHcXjCYvGuc2sd
transaction
dd1cd515a280deebc3f50ba828e4e5413e2e4e08ff0d18672779f1978cc512d7
confirmations
294361
spent
true